Changes in nucleosomal core histone variants during chicken development and maturation.

M K Urban, A Zweidler

    Developmental Biology
    |February 1, 1983
    PubMed
    Summary

    Chicken core histone variants H2A, H2B, and H3 change during development and maturation. Their proportions are linked to growth rate, not cell differentiation, with H3.3 increasing significantly in adult tissues.

    Area of Science:

    • Biochemistry
    • Developmental Biology
    • Molecular Biology

    Background:

    • Core histones (H2A, H2B, H3) exist as primary structure variants.
    • These variants are found in varying proportions across different adult chicken tissues.

    Purpose of the Study:

    • To quantitatively analyze chicken core histone variants during embryonic development and posthatching maturation.
    • To investigate the relationship between histone variant proportions and growth rate versus cell differentiation.

    Main Methods:

    • Polyacrylamide gel electrophoresis in nonionic detergents to resolve histone variants.
    • Quantitative analysis of histone components throughout chicken development.

    Main Results:

    • H2A variants remain in similar proportions throughout development and in adult tissues.

  • H2B and H3 variants show developmental changes, with a second variant appearing and increasing.
  • Posthatching, minor H2B and H3 variant levels differ based on tissue mitotic activity; H3.3 becomes predominant in non-dividing adult tissues.
  • Conclusions:

    • Changes in chicken core histone variant proportions correlate with growth rate, not cell differentiation.
    • Replication-independent incorporation likely explains the increase of H3.3 in adult, non-dividing cells.
